学习
实践
活动
工具
TVP
写文章

BPM架构】Camunda BPM 最佳实践

无论您选择哪种实施模型(在此处了解有关实施模型的更多信息:BPM 平台:独立和微服务实施),业务分析师和 BPM 平台程序员都可以在同一个 Camunda 项目上一起工作。 BPM 平台“圣杯”:无代码概念 我什么时候需要程序员? 现在,您可能想知道:“如果存在无代码 BPM 平台——我为什么还需要程序员? 实施 Camunda BPM 流程时的最佳最佳实践 现在,当我们知道如何建立在 Camunda BPM 中工作的团队时,让我们专注于业务专家和 IT 工程师在建模流程方面的最佳实践和工具。 但是当所有部分都存在时,我们清楚地看到这些步骤调用了外部系统。我们甚至知道他们对外部系统使用了哪些特定的 REST 请求! 在对流程进行整体分析时,公司从上述方法中受益。 这种行为很容易实现,但需要在下一次重试流程中覆盖对外部系统的所有数据更改。当然,这些更改不会影响相应系统中的任何业务相关流程)。 第二种是使用默认的 Camunda 的“重试和等待”机制。

30550

BPM架构】BPM 平台:独立还是微服务实现

事实证明,协调服务、系统和业务任务的 BPM 模型和支持 IT 平台是实现业务流程的可靠来源。 那就是微服务出现的时候。 有两种最流行的建模方法: BPM 平台可以是一个单一的 IT 系统,它将在一个地方为业务流程编排和配置规则。 BPM 引擎可以是微服务的一部分,包含特定的子流程。 微服务架构中的 Camunda BPM 微服务架构引入了一种不同的 IT 系统设计方法,其中具有大量业务功能的大型单一单体被专为业务目的设计的较小的自主服务所取代。 使用这种方法,即使您认为 Camunda BPM 不再满足所有需求,也可以轻松地以小功能块迁移到其他解决方案。 遗留系统与微服务共存的情况可能具有挑战性。 微服务团队和遗留系统业务团队应该围绕数据一致性和数据所有权展开合作。事实上,拥有微服务迟早会导致遗留系统分解,这对整个组织和 IT 系统管理都是一个挑战。

30160
  • 广告
    关闭

    热门业务场景教学

    个人网站、项目部署、开发环境、游戏服务器、图床、渲染训练等免费搭建教程,多款云服务器20元起。

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    流程引擎BPM对比

    今天小编介绍了三家,请往下看: 雀书: 雀书主打无代码搭建BPM业务管理流程,为多家大型企业提供办公平台,助企业提高办公效率。 产品定位为业务流程管理软件(即bpm软件),主要用于企业的流程管理,审批等场景。采用无代码开发,通过拖拉组件,可以快速完成流程表单的设计。 四、集成能力 业务系统与雀书BPM集成、开放API、雀书可以通过webhook获取外部系统数据。 五、业务流程案例 广发证券流程中心:端到端的业务流程,不像简单的请假流程。 广发有人事等多个子系统,子系统,流程详情如下图: 炎黄盈动 炎黄盈动是通过AWS PaaS强大得流程引擎赋能三方系统,推动已有系统流程和数据得流转,增强流程集中管控能力;借助AWS PaaS卓越得移动 结语: 究竟哪一个BPM最终解决方案适合你的企业,BPM解决方案要有足够广泛的定制选项,能满足你企业的成长的需要,能够实现你的企业独特的需求等都是要考虑的。

    6850

    介绍一套BPM系统应该有的功能

    前言 近几年IT行业各种IT应用发展十分迅猛,企业和公司内部信息管理系统越来越多。 由于一些原因,这些系统的信息资源管理分散、共享困难、由此造成了一些信息孤岛。 现在越来越多的企业要求数据集中、统一、智能化管理,所以如何科学管理和合理开发这些信息系统,成了目前公司以及一些IT公司面临的巨大难题。 BPM能解决什么问题 帮助提高核心业务流程的有效性和效率 帮助提升整体灵活性以进行快速交付,并可以适应各种业务流程上面的变化。 那有的BPM框架应该具体哪些功能 1、业务流程治理中心(process center): 能统一管理各类业务流程、服务以及各种适配器 能统一实现业务流程的测试、模拟、部署

    1.6K20

    Flowportal BPM 邮件提醒内容

    邮件中加入审批按钮: 1、在系统表BPMSysSettings中增加一行记录ItemName = ClickToProcessHTTP ItemValue=http://www.xxx.com/BPM 在流程的邮件提醒的内容里加入<%=Context.Current.CreateProcessLinks()%> 在邮件中加入,查看详细信息链接: <a href=”http://www.xxx.com/BPM

    35810

    BPM是什么意思?BPM的优势及好处有哪些?

    合并这套BPM背后的主要思想是通过减少手动工作来提高生产率。4、业务流程管理生命周期业务流程是由系统和人员为实现业务目标而执行的一组活动、任务和事件。 绘制人和系统之间的工作流,并评估任何依赖性或移交。在这一步中,流程是为条件、期限、数据流等的可视化表示而设计的。执行:执行上一步中确定和设计的流程。这可以手动或使用自动化来完成。 衡量流程的效率,相应地实施变更,并审查整体绩效,使企业能够消除系统中的瓶颈。优化:根据上述分析,我们可以使用各种业务改进步骤来优化流程,以进一步提高流程效率并降低成本。 而优化BPM就是其中之一。员工将有更多时间关注工作场所的创新和重要活动。另一方面,客户将通过享受更好的服务和产品,从这种模式转变中受益。3、扩充策略一旦将BPM引入系统,战略就会得到加强。 而当企业把BPM引入这样一个杂事繁多且事物重要的部门时,企业管理者就可以减轻负担,使整个系统变得顺畅。差旅申请、报销等事情统统都能快速处理!

    20540

    BPM产业数字观察:中国市场趋向成熟,蛰伏的BPM即将醒来

    1 国产化 2013年,国产BPM迎来高光时刻,大量专业国产BPM产品进入大企业客户采购名录,并且成功替换国际一线大厂品牌, ERP系的系统集成商(大量原Workflow供应商)被挤出,一批国产化BPM 品牌H3 BPM(奥哲网络)、宏天软件、炎黄盈动、天翎等不断开始为中国企业提供专业的BPM服务,并潜移默化中击退国际品牌,BPM的国产专业化路径越来越清晰。 相比同时代的CRM、协同OA等系统级企业应用(平均每年符合增长率保持在40%以上),BPM的增长并不那么“凶悍”,仅维持在20%左右的增长率。 纵向来看,技术的进步令产品应用的门槛降低,过往只能在大型、超大型企业当中才能看到的专业BPM系统/应用,开始逐步向中小企业辐射;横向来看,BPM的应用聚集圈逐步从超一线、一线经济发达区域向三、四线区域扩张 更多对中国BPM市场的剖析与数字动态,在看明天发布的全版《2019年中国BPM市场行业洞察报告》。

    42231

    Flowportal.Net 3.5t BPM系统报表导出限制的解决办法

    今天用户说要导出Flowportal.Net 3.5t BPM系统中的某个流程的记录做分析,但是不管怎么选择,最多只能导出1000行数据。我记得好像原来询问过供应商这个问题,倒是我忘记修改了。

    31510

    Flowportal.Net BPM升级小计

    第一个安装的Flowportal.Net BPM版本是3.5m,后来本地测试完成之后,正式购买的时候安装了3.5n的版本,年前从官方获得了最新4.0版本的安装文件,因为最新版本是一个全新版本,无法兼容以前的版本 在本地测试的时候,第一次没升级成功,因为升级的时候,我的IE浏览器、BPM企业管理器都开着呢,所以后来只能从安装文件包中复制所有的文件,然后覆盖到了Flowportal.Net安装文件夹。

    24630

    BPM与ERP软件的区别

    BPM系统使您的企业可以通过ERP系统根本无法提供的定制级别来管理该工作流程。存在ERP流程管理,但是ERP并不总是提供与BPM系统相同的粒度数据。 两者都提供商业智能 两种系统都使用您的KPI和自定义报告来提供分析。但是,BPM可以跟踪特定过程的效力。BPM的商业智能(BI)工具可洞察流程执行时间,流程状态,已关闭流程的数量和已打开流程的数量。 通常,当ERP不能像BPM那样管理流程时,BPM会集成到更大的ERP系统中。当您尝试解决这些问题时,这可能导致您的业务效率低下和繁琐的解决方法。 BPM系统突出显示了企业中重要的流程,否则ERP会越过这些流程。更高的详细程度增强了BPM管理的流程,从而允许较大的ERP促进更一般的业务功能。 如果整合得当,两者实际上可以通过填补空白而相互补充。 鉴于此ERP BPM比较,您计划实施哪种软件系统?让我们在下面发表评论吧!

    95540

    顶级免费和开源BPM软件

    业务流程管理软件对您业务的重要性 由于其不断发展和高效的BPM技术解决方案,业务流程管理软件是现有IT行业的一种创新解决方案。 BPM软件提供广泛的流程自动化,提高生产力并确保合规性。 此外,与专有BPM软件供应商相比,开源BPM软件提供了更可靠且极具成本效益的替代方案,从而为更好的业务解决方案创造了空间。 10个最佳免费和开源BPM软件: 1.Bonitasoft ? 2.Red Hat JBoss BPM suite ? 该套件在单个BPM平台上集成了业务流程管理,资源规划,事件处理和规则管理的功能。 它拥有20年的历史,为软件开发人员,系统架构师,分析师等提供高端功能。 Modelio非常灵活。 您可以配置自己的模块,软件将根据您的需求进行调整。 它可以在多种语言和多种平台上使用,例如Windows,Linux,FreeBSD和Solaris操作系统。 9.Orchestra ?

    4.6K50

    Flowportal.Net BPM升级小计2

    上次BPM升级后,经过几天的使用,只发现了一个升级造成的问题,是在一个新员工招聘入职流程里写了一个C#的步骤来触发其他流程,下图是出错信息: 经过和厂商确认,把原来的写法:“process.CreateTask

    47520

    成功BPM项目的5个必要步骤

    决定一个BPM项目是否能成功的因素有很多,我这里讨论的是对任何业务流程都适用的步骤,而不仅仅是技术的实现步骤等。 以上文字是我近几年来对BPM项目的个人见解,用上去的话对BPM项目的胜算就会大些,也欢迎大家补充。

    66720

    BPM和ERP、OA的区别关系

    我们可以将企业的经营活动分为战略层、运营层和作业层,完整的IT信息系统规划提供对这三个层面的支持,BPM得以有效集成ERP作业层管理将使得企业战略、决策和作业的敏捷化、自动化提升到一个前所未有的新高度。 企业经营管控是对企业的组织(人)和业务过程(事)的管控,OA系统重在强调以个人为中心的信息协作,自主发散、行为无序的将信息通过协作工具进行传递和沟通,而BPM则是以端到端为中心的协作(人与人、人与系统、 企业在BPM与ERP集成目标的突破口: 弥补ERP流程管控能力的不足(外延和内伸) 利用BPM对各类费用审批实施流程自动化,后端集成到ERP系统 利用BPM处理前端客户线索、研发、订单、开具发票等流程 ,后端集成到ERP系统 利用BPM扩展物料采购、BOM变更等,后端集成到ERP系统 利用BPM实现对资产周期过程控制(采购、入库、领用、转移、维修、报废等) 突发性流程控制,例如对紧急订单处理、紧急发货处理等 ,后端集成到ERP系统 利用BPM增强人力资源流程,例如招聘、入职、请假、异动流程 声明:文章属原创。

    1.3K80

    企业级BPM之微服务架构演进

    这种部署架构显然是更加复杂了,但却是从工作流走向BPM的关键一步。 因为BPM的目标是将多个业务系统间的流程连在一起,将多个业务应用中的流程集中管理,其所服务的对象也不仅仅是开发人员而是面向企业管理。 企业级BPM是指在公司总部及各省(市)公司构建集中的“BPM流程服务资源池”,将原来由各应用使用的BPM组件统一收归至总部及各省公司集中部署与运维,集中纳管各系统流程模型及流程运行实例,体现出“统一流程标准 组织机构服务在工作项处理等模块中会被频繁使用,BPM提供接口供业务系统接入时实现,比如在国家电网的实现是统一权限系统ISC。 故障隔离不使整个系统陷入瘫痪也是微服务架构的价值之一。 ? 业务规则引擎是BPM平台的一项基础服务,PVM做流程调度时基于它计算分支,工作项模块生成人工任务时基于它计算参与者。 本次分享针对企业级BPM平台做了一次微服务架构演进的思考,每个领域的it系统它的运行方式、计算特点、架构风格都是不同的,深入理解自己的系统,才能选择最合适的方式进行微服务架构探索。

    1.7K103

    Flowportal.Net BPM中如何重发邮件

    用户说没收到审批通过的邮件,经过查实那天的邮件发送因为SMTP的问题都发送失败了,经过咨询Flowportal.Net BPM的技术人员,原来每条邮件提醒都存储在数据库中,并且分处存放,所以通过直接操作数据库就很容易地实现了邮件的重新发送

    36430

    扫码关注腾讯云开发者

    领取腾讯云代金券